I really like how the game combines point-and-click adventure gameplay with RPG mechanics. It seems to me like such a logical thing to do with an RPG, yet I can't think of many other examples aside from Quest for Glory. Grinding for karma hasn't been an issue for me so far, but I am a bit tight on money as everything in the game is really expensive and the enemies don't drop much.
Only gripe I have so far is that your party members can't level up, so I'm a bit worried that Kitsune is going to fall out of usefulness real soon. Probably for the better though, since if I could upgrade her invisibility spell then I'd have effective invincibility for the whole game.
